traditional pub in a picturesque village setting

Weโ€™re very lucky at the Plough Inn to have an enviable spot right by the village pond & green in the beautiful seaside village of Rottingdean.

The pub dates back to the 1840s, and some of the original flint walls are still intact from that time. The impressive brick building is home to a popular and vibrant village pub with a great reputation for both food and drink.

Step inside and youโ€™ll find not only a cosy traditional pub, complete with oak beams and wood panelling, but also a warm welcome and friendly service. We are child and dog friendly too!
